    Background

    UBE2F antibody detects NEDD8-conjugating enzyme E2 F, an E2 ubiquitin-like conjugating enzyme that catalyzes neddylation of cullin proteins, regulating cullin-RING ligase (CRL) activity. The UniProt recommended name is NEDD8-conjugating enzyme E2 F (UBE2F). This enzyme cooperates with the NEDD8-activating enzyme (NAE1/UBA3) and specific E3 ligases to attach NEDD8 to target substrates, modulating protein degradation pathways.

    Functionally, UBE2F antibody identifies a 185-amino-acid cytoplasmic enzyme that activates and transfers NEDD8 to cullin 5 and other CRL components. UBE2F works specifically with the E3 ligase RBX2 (RNF7), forming a selective neddylation module distinct from UBE2M (UBC12). Through this modification, UBE2F regulates CRL activity, affecting cell cycle progression, signal transduction, and stress responses.

    The UBE2F gene is located on chromosome 5q31.2 and is expressed in multiple tissues, including testis, brain, and lung. Its expression is cell cycle-dependent and induced under oxidative stress. UBE2F ensures timely activation of CRLs, thereby influencing ubiquitin-mediated degradation of regulatory proteins such as p27 and HIF1A.

    Pathologically, dysregulation of UBE2F contributes to cancer and oxidative stress-related disorders. Overexpression promotes degradation of tumor suppressors, while inhibition can stabilize proteins that restrain cell proliferation. UBE2F has emerged as a therapeutic target for modulating proteostasis and redox balance in malignant cells.

    Structurally, UBE2F contains a conserved catalytic cysteine residue within its E2 core domain, forming a thioester bond with activated NEDD8. This structure enables transfer to substrate-bound E3 ligases. This antibody helps characterize UBE2F's mechanistic role in the neddylation cascade and its impact on CRL activity.
